Global Radio to launch TV channels

July 3, 2012

The UK’s largest commercial radio operator, Global Radio, is expanding into television with the launch of two music channels based on its Heart and Capital brands.

Global Radio, which also owns Classic FM and the talk station LBC, will launch Heart TV and Capital TV on Sky and Freesat, the satellite channel jointly owned by the BBC and ITV, in September.

Global said the channels will play “non-stop” music videos and will “deepen and enhance the clear brand identities of the Heart and Capital brands targeting audiences in the same demographics as the radio stations”.
